Module: Corzinus::Flashable

Extended by:
ActiveSupport::Concern
Included in:
ApplicationController, Controllable
Defined in:
app/controllers/concerns/corzinus/flashable.rb

Instance Method Summary collapse

Instance Method Details

#flash_render(template, flash_messages = {}) ⇒ Object



5
6
7
8
9
10
11
# File 'app/controllers/concerns/corzinus/flashable.rb', line 5

def flash_render(template, flash_messages = {})
  support_flash = [:notice, :alert]
  flash_messages.each do |type, message|
    flash.now[type] = message if support_flash.include?(type)
  end
  render template
end